description
Welwyn Hatfield Borough Council wishes to secure best value from the operation of its Campus West facilities, and to deliver fantastic opportunities for local people and visitors to use this landmark facility for years to come. The intention is to gain a better understanding of how best to use the space currently occupied by Roller City.
To achieve this, we ask parties who have a genuine interest in developing and / or operating this type of facility to complete a questionnaire and maybe have an exploratory discussion with our appointed consultants.
